Introduction:

While TestNG is a powerful and versatile testing framework, it's essential to recognize that no tool is without limitations. Understanding the disadvantages of TestNG can aid in making informed decisions in automation testing.

Disadvantages of TestNG:

**1. Learning Curve:

  • Complexity for Beginners:
    • For beginners in automation testing, TestNG's features and advanced functionalities may present a steeper learning curve compared to simpler testing frameworks.

**2. Overhead in Configuration:

  • Configuration Complexity:
    • In certain scenarios, configuring TestNG XML files for complex test suites may become intricate and require a deep understanding of the framework's syntax.

**3. Dependency on Annotations:

  • Annotation-Centric Structure:
    • TestNG relies heavily on annotations for defining test methods, test classes, and other configuration elements.
    • Some testers may find this annotation-centric structure restrictive or overwhelming.

**4. Limited Reporting Features:

  • Basic Reporting:
    • While TestNG provides basic HTML reports, more advanced and visually appealing reporting features are available in other testing frameworks.

**5. Parallel Execution Challenges:

  • Complex Parallel Execution:
    • While TestNG supports parallel execution, configuring and managing parallel tests can be complex, especially for large test suites.

**6. Integration with Other Frameworks:

  • Integration Challenges:
    • Integrating TestNG with certain continuous integration (CI) tools or external frameworks may require additional effort, leading to integration challenges.
